IP 地址 : 21.73.231.13
IP InfoIP 地址 | 21.73.231.13 |
---|---|
rDNS | 13.231.73.21.in-addr.arpa |
主机名 | - |
最近查找
- 11.109.82.254
- 3.120.89.194
- 14.147.109.3
- 33.219.134.24
- 17.237.75.200
- 154.141.144.92
- 3.45.11.109
- 58.243.242.123
- 1.247.140.28
- 172.4.178.249
- 2.78.39.121
- 107.124.235.82
- 44.137.181.57
- 5.144.86.243
- 16.163.35.182
- 7.138.109.146
- 41.254.165.213
- 55.43.48.87
- 40.192.158.252
- 186.209.199.142
- 28.101.1.221
- 20.205.68.145
- 45.20.198.253
- 54.126.91.137
- 5.106.53.4
- 27.2.134.194
- 58.178.143.212
- 1.212.17.172
- 44.134.146.57